TOP

SELECT ステートメントの TOP 句は、テーブルの最初のレコードから開始して、返すレコードの数を指定します。

構文

SELECT TOP <number> <column_name>
FROM <table>

備考

TOP は、返されるレコードの数を制限することで、特に非常に大きなテーブルが関係している場合に、パフォーマンスを向上させることができます。
number 引数は、返される行数を表す整数です。
TOP を ORDER BY 句と共に使用して、指定した行数が定義された順序になっていることを確認します。

PROCEDURE LookupProduct (OUT result CURSOR (ProductDescription VARCHAR (255) ) ) 
    BEGIN
        OPEN result FOR SELECT 
                TOP 5 products.ProductDescription
            FROM /shared/examples/ds_inventory/tutorial/products products;
    END